CHAPTER 154.
AN ACT to authorize the County Commissioners of Harford and Talbot counties to divide any of the election districts in said counties into election precincts, and to designate the places of holding elections therein.
|
|
Make divis'ns
|
SECTION 1. Be it enacted by the General Assembly of Maryland, That the County Commissioners of Harford and Talbot counties be and they are hereby authorized to make such divisions of any election district or districts, in said counties, into election precincts as in their judgment the public interest may require; and to designate the places of holding elections therein and the number by which each of said precincts shall be known.
|
|
Separate lists.
|
SEC. 2. And be it enacted, That it shall be the duty of the officer of registration in each election district, so divided into precincts, when notified by the county commissioners of such division of any such-district prior to the next election in said counties, to register all the voters in such district, in the same mode and manner as the voters in other districts are required to be registered by the registration laws of the State of Maryland; and he shall prepare separate lists of voters according to the sub-divisions of such districts into precincts as hereinbefore provided, designating the election precincts of the districts in which the voters are or shall be respectively entitled to vote, and shall deliver one copy of the lists of voters for each of said precincts to the judges of election thereof.
